Night shift: evacuation-chair store on Stairwell C, Level 3, was restocked today. Two Havermont chairs serviced, one sent to Drayle Safety for repair. Check the seal on the store door at 02:00 rounds. If the seal is broken, log it and re-secure. Door access for the store uses the pass below.

staff pass of fajop-kajop = bdg-H-83

Headcount Plan Briefing — Leadership Review

For the incoming director: next year's plan adds twelve roles across the Farrowgate engineering group and trims four in Dunlin support operations. Ravella in People Ops has validated the costings, and the phasing aligns with the Q2 budget cycle. The sensitive element of the plan is recorded directly below.

management briefing: Eliaxax Works is in early talks to buy Casoxox Systems for about $61.5 million. The Framir launch date is May 17, and nothing goes to the press before then.

### Quick intro: Spoolbert (for the weekly sync)

Spoolbert is our printer-spooler microservice — it queues print jobs from the office apps and meters them out so the big floor printers don't choke. If you're demoing it at the sync, run it locally against the internal Jobvault queue; it's lightweight and fine on a laptop. You'll need the shared dev credential to enqueue anything, so here it is.

gateway credential: kto23_LX9A4ys6i4nzHtpOLNLodKK

**Vendor note: Inkmill markdown pipeline**

Rendering for Parchway docs is outsourced to Inkmill under an annual contract, renewing each March. They handle sanitization and PDF export; we own the upload queue. SLA: 4-hour response on rendering failures. Escalate only after two failed retries. Their support desk is reachable at the address below.

billing contact of hahaf-baguf = zorael.tammir.jorius@sivrelhq.internal

Subject: Chip reader key rotation — heads up

Hi! Welcome aboard. Quick one: we rotated the credential the Stridepath chip readers use to push split times into Pacebourne. The old key dies Friday, so flash any readers you're prepping with the new one before race weekend. Config goes in `reader.toml` under `[auth]`. Ping the timing channel if a reader won't sync. Use the key below.

API key for kahop-bagef: zpat2_yb